refactor(types): add comprehensive type annotations across backend Python codebase
Enable ANN rules in ruff.toml (flake8-annotations) and resolve all 221 violations: ANN201/ANN202 — return types on 168 public/private functions: - All 28 FastAPI routers: endpoints annotated with dict/list/specific schema/ StreamingResponse/FileResponse/JSONResponse as appropriate - main.py: lifespan→AsyncGenerator[None,None], exception handlers→JSONResponse - database.py: get_db→Generator[Session,None,None], proxy methods→correct types - middleware/request_context.py: dispatch→Response with Callable call_next type ANN001/ANN002/ANN003 — 32 missing argument types: - seed_demo.py: all db parameters typed as Session - domain/unit_of_work.py: __aexit__ exc_type/exc_val/exc_tb typed with TracebackType - services: audit_service user_id→UUID|None, heatmap_service query/model/builder, notification_service test→Test, tempo_service test→Test/user→User, test_workflow_service test_id→UUID, campaign_crud **fields→object, test_crud **fields→object (4 sites) ANN401 — 16 Any usages resolved: - Domain entities (campaign/technique/threat_actor/test_entity): replaced Any with actual ORM types via TYPE_CHECKING guards to avoid circular imports - detection_rule_service: test_id/detection_rule_id/evaluator_id→UUID - score_cache: kept Any with # noqa: ANN401 (genuinely generic cache) - jira_service/tempo_service: kept Any with # noqa: ANN401 (lazy optional deps) - d3fend_import_service: _to_str(v: Any) kept with # noqa: ANN401 ANN204/ANN205/ANN206 — special/static/class methods: - database.py proxy __call__/__getattr__: *args: object/**kwargs: object - schemas/test.py model_validate: obj→object, **kwargs→object - sa_technique_repository._int_type→type All 439 unit tests pass. ruff check app/ → All checks passed!
